  • Patent number: 9572794
    Abstract: Embodiments of the invention include substituted indole compounds and compositions thereof to inhibit protease activated receptor-4. Also described are methods of preparation of compositions and methods for treating diseases related to thrombotic disorders by administration of the composition.
